What is the difference between Entry Level Power Bi Developer vs Data Analyst?

AspectEntry Level Power Bi DeveloperData Analyst
Required CredentialsBasic knowledge of Power BI, SQL, and data visualization toolsProficiency in Excel, SQL, and data analysis techniques
Work EnvironmentTypically in IT or Business Intelligence teams, focusing on dashboard developmentOften in business units, focusing on data interpretation and reporting
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across industries for reporting and dashboard creationUsed across industries for data interpretation and decision support
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ding entry-level Power BI roles and skillsComparing Power BI development with general data analysis roles

The main difference is that Entry Level Power Bi Developers focus on creating dashboards and reports using Power BI, often with some SQL knowledge, while Data Analysts perform broader data interpretation and analysis, sometimes using Power BI as a tool. Both roles are essential in data-driven organizations but differ in scope and daily tasks.

What do entry level Power BI developers do?

As an Entry Level Power BI Developer, you will often start by supporting data analysts and senior developers with tasks like cleaning and preparing data, creating basic reports and dashboards, and updating existing Power BI solutions. You'll likely collaborate closely with business users to understand reporting requirements and help troubleshoot data visualization issues. Over time, you'll gain experience in automating data refreshes, integrating new data sources, and optimizing dashboards, all while learning best practices in data governance and visualization.

What is an entry level Power BI developer?

An Entry Level Power BI Developer is a professional who uses Microsoft Power BI to create data visualizations, dashboards, and reports to help organizations make data-driven decisions. They typically work with business analysts and data engineers to collect, transform, and analyze data from various sources. This role is ideal for individuals new to business intelligence and data analytics, usually requiring basic knowledge of Power BI, data modeling, and DAX (Data Analysis Expressions). Entry level developers often support senior team members and gain hands-on experience through real-world projects.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as an entry level Power BI developer?

To thrive as an Entry Level Power BI Developer, you need a solid understanding of data analysis, data visualization, and basic SQL or database concepts, often supported by a degree in computer science, information systems, or related fields. Familiarity with Power BI, DAX (Data Analysis Expressions), and Microsoft Excel is typically required, and obtaining a Microsoft Power BI certification can be advantageous.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help you interpret business requirements and present insights clearly. These skills ensure you can transform raw data into actionable reports, supporting informed decision-making within organizations.
